Ensure operation of machinery, equipment, and facilities by completing preventive maintenance requirements on engines, motors, pneumatic tools, conveyor systems, and production machines; following diagrams, sketches, operations manuals, manufacturer’s instructions, and engineering specifications; troubleshooting malfunctions.
Locate source(s) of problems by observing devices in operation; listening for problems; using precision measuring and testing instruments.
Remove defective part(s) by dismantling devices; using hoists, cranes, and hand/power tools; examining form, fitment, and texture of parts.
Determine changes in dimensional requirements of parts by inspecting used parts, using rules, calipers, micrometers, and other precision measuring instruments.
Adjust functional parts of devices and control instruments by using hand tools, levels, plumb bobs, and straightedges.
Fabricate repair parts by using machine shop instrumentation and equipment.
Maintain equipment, parts, and supplies inventory by scanning parts to be used into an automated inventory system.
Conserve maintenance resources by using equipment and supplies as needed to accomplish job results.
Provide maintenance information by entering job steps and tips into work order reports.
Maintain continuity among maintenance teams by attending daily meetings and communicating actions, irregularities, and continuing needs.
Maintain a safe and clean working environment by complying with procedures, rules, and regulations.
